WebCineole definition, a colorless, oily, slightly water-soluble liquid terpene ether, C10H18O, having a camphorlike odor and a pungent, spicy, cooling taste, found in eucalyptus, cajeput, and other essential oils: used in flavoring, perfumery, and medicine chiefly as an expectorant. WebStructure of Cineole If you observe the molecular structure of cineole, you will realize it is a monoterpene. If you have been reading our previous posts, you are probably aware that monoterpenes have 10 carbon atoms due to the synergy of two isoprenes. It comes to boil at 176° C and it is a colorless and transparent liquid. WebAccording to recent research, cineole is the isolated active agent of eucalyptus oil and possesses antimicrobial activity. Other names: Dehydrocineole; 1,3,3-Trimethyl-2-oxabicyclo [2.2.2]oct-5-ene; Dehydro-1,8-cineole; Dehydro-1,8-cineol; 1,8-Dehydrocineole; 2,3-dehydro-1,8-cineol; Dehydro-1,8-cyneole; … WebCineole combines with acids (phosphoric, arsenic, hydrochloride, etc.) to form loose compounds that are easily decomposed when treated with water. This fact is commonly used in the estimation of cineole in essential oils. (i) The phosphoric acid process. WebJun 7, 2024 · Cineole. Cineole is naturally produced cyclic ether and monoterpenoid. Cineole is an ingredient in many brands of mouthwash and cough suppressant. It controls airway mucus hypersecretion and asthma via anti-inflammatory cytokine inhibition. Cineole is an effective treatment for nonpurulent rhinosinusitis.
